CC Resolution No. 2976 RESOLUTION 2976 A RESOLUTION OF THE CITY COUNCIL OF THE CITY OF BAYTOWN, TEXAS, ESTABLISHING THE 2025 BOND COMMITTEE; MAKING OTHER PROVISIONS RELATED THERETO; AND PROVIDING FOR THE EFFECTIVE DATE THEREOF. ************************************************************************************* WHEREAS, the City of Baytown desires to issue bonds in the November 2025 General Election for the purpose of funding significant infrastructure projects to support our growing community; and WHEREAS,prior to the November 2025 General Election,the City Council of the City of Baytown desires to create a Bond Committee to assist the City in organizing, researching and preparing potential projects for consideration in the Election; NOW THEREFORE BE IT RESOLVED BY THE CITY COUNCIL OF THE CITY OF BAYTOWN, TEXAS: Section 1: The recitals contained in the preamble of this resolution are true and correct and are adopted as findings of the City Council of the City of Baytown. Section 2: The City of Baytown hereby establishes the 2025 Baytown Citizen Bond Advisory Committee(the"Committee")as follows: a. Created; composition. The Committee shall consist of fifteen(15) members. b. Purpose. The purpose of the Committee is to assist the City in organizing researching,and preparing the potential projects for consideration in the November 2025 General Bond Elections. C. Duties. The Committee shall receive input form diverse community groups within the City to better understand residents needs. The Committee shall recommend proposed projects to the City Council based on community input. d. Appointments. 1. Terms of Office. Members of the Committee shall be appointed by the City Council and shall serve until the conclusion of the November 2025 Bond Election. Due to the short-term nature of this Committee, members of the Committee are eligible to serve on two additional Council-appointed boards within the City. 2. Appointments. Each member of the City Council shall appoint two(2)district- specific members to the Committee. The Mayor shall appoint three (3) at- large members to the Committee. e. Meetings. The Committee shall select and name Co-Chairs and Subcommitee Chairs. Meetings of the Committee and Subcommittees shall be scheduled and established as determined by the Co-Chairs and Subcommittee Chairs. Section 3: This resolution shall take effect immediately from and after its passage by the City Council of the City of Baytown, Texas. INTRODUCED, READ and PASSED by the City Council of the City of Baytown this the 13"'day of February, 2025.
